In a nutshell: Ken Shirriff is an IC opposite engineering enthusiast who enjoys restoring antique computer systems and devices. While repairing an 8-inch HP floppy pressure, the laptop historian determined an obsolete production generation that became almost lost to time.
The antique floppy power had a damaged interface chip, Shirriff defined on his blog. He determined to decap it and took pictures. The chip has an uncommon substrate, which include a sapphire base with silicon factors and steel wiring on top. The "silicon-on-sapphire" chip is in part transparent, Shirriff notes, and changed into designed to characteristic as an interface among HP's interface bus (HP-IB) and the Z80 processor, which acts because the important hub inside the floppy power controller.
The silicon-on-sapphire chip is a PHI (Processor-to-HP-IB Interface) factor, utilized in various HP merchandise to manage the bus protocol and buffered statistics among the interface bus and a tool's microprocessor. The sapphire substrate imparts the chip with particular abilties, which Shirriff elaborates on in his put up.
Unlike a normal integrated circuit, the transistors on the chip are absolutely isolated due to the fact the sapphire substrate serves as an insulator. This means there is decreased capacitance between transistors, improving overall performance and imparting safety towards radiation or low-impedance short circuits.
Thanks to its natural hardening skills towards radiation, the silicon-on-sapphire configuration have been used considering the fact that 1963 or earlier, such as in spacecraft just like the Galileo probe. Shirriff in comparison the PHI chip to different processors from the 70s, which were made from each silicon-on-sapphire and silicon-most effective substrates.
HP's MC2 16-bit processor from 1977 utilized silicon-on-sapphire generation and had 10,000 transistors, in step with the historian, running at 8 megahertz on simply 350 mW of electricity. In contrast, the Intel 8086 16-bit CPU from 1978 was applied on a "regular" silicon substrate the usage of NMOS instead of the CMOS manufacturing manner. The chip had 29,000 transistors, ran at 5 megahertz first of all, and ate up up to 2.5 watts of energy.
While silicon-on-sapphire substrates provided a few advantages in terms of overall performance and electricity intake, as Shirriff's examination confirms, they weren't as densely filled with transistors as silicon ones. Furthermore, "crystal incompatibilities" between silicon and sapphire made production tough, resulting in a nine percentage yield for HP. This issue in all likelihood played a sizeable function in setting up silicon because the cloth of desire for IC production in next years.
